Deciphering Added Value Over the Past 10 Years

We have estimated the 10 year cumulative dollar impact of fees using:

  • Top down public fee rates from appendix of quarterly reports to trustees (for 2005-2013 data).
  • Bottom up public fees from internal analysis by Bureau of Asset Management (for 2014 data).
  • Estimated annualized net cash flows.
